Seahawks QB Geno Smith plans to use his legs a little bit more to add an extra element to what defenses have to account for. Last year, Smith rushed for 155 yards on 37 carries. In 2022, he ran for 366 yards.
Geno Smith: “Last year, really midway through the season, I felt I could have used my legs a little bit more. That’s something I want to continue to do. I’m still very athletic. I play within the pocket, that’s the base of my game, but I think I can add an extra element to what defenses have to account for if I get a couple extra first downs or a couple extra touchdowns.”
Any added rushing for Smith would be excellent for his fantasy value.
Though new OC Ryan Grubb hasn't put a focus on QB rushing in his college offenses, a more spread style could lend itself to some QB Draws and Blasts throughout the season for Smith.
Even if Smith can get back to 350-400 yards rushing on the season, it would add 20 fantasy points on the season to make him a rock solid QB2.
Keep an eye on the talk around Smith's rushing. If the buzz continues, he is a likely value in Superflex and Best Ball leagues.
